- The IKRA IHS 650 electric hedge saw is a practical tool designed for easily and precisely trimming hedges, shrubs, and ornamental plants. Powered by a 650W electric motor, it delivers consistent performance during cutting and helps achieve a uniform and clean appearance. Featuring a long 61cm blade, it allows you to cut larger areas in less time, and its lightweight design and comfortable handle provide excellent control, making it an ideal choice for home gardens and landscaping projects.

Product specifications
- Brand: IKRA
- Model: IHS 650
- Type of device: Electric fence saw
- Power: 650 watts (approximately 0.9 horsepower)
- Power source: Electricity
- Knife length: 61 cm (approximately 24 inches)
- Actual cutting length: approximately 55-57 cm
- Blade type: Dual Action
- Maximum cutting thickness: approximately 18-20 mm
- Approximate weight: 3-3.5 kg
- Country of origin: China
- Uses: Trimming and shaping hedges and plants

👨🌾 Orchid Advice
- For optimal trimming, trim the sides of the fence first and then the top, as this helps maintain a balanced shape and prevents branches from falling off during the work.
⭐ Important addition
- It is preferable to trim hedges regularly rather than cutting a large quantity at once, because frequent light trimming gives a neat shape and reduces stress on the knife and motor.
⚠️ Safety Warnings
- Not suitable for cutting thick branches or hardwood.
- It is recommended to wear protective gloves and goggles during operation.
- Do not use in humid places or in the rain.
- Always disconnect the electricity before cleaning or maintenance.
